Abstract
The utility model provides a cooking machine (100), including frame (1) and assemble in cooking cup (2) of frame (1), cooking cup (2) bottom equipment has the magnetic conduction dish, the correspondence of magnetic conduction dish below is provided with coil panel subassembly (3), the coil panel subassembly includes coil bracket and electromagnetic heating coil, electromagnetic heating coil includes first coil (33) at least, the cross-section of first coil (33) divide into first wide cross-section and first narrow cross-section, the unit cross sectional area in first wide cross-section is greater than the unit cross sectional area in first narrow cross-section. The utility model discloses a set up the cross-section of the coil of coil panel subassembly into the form of variable cross-section for it is little to be located that the cross-section of coil panel subassembly is close to center coil's cross-section than edge coil's cross-section, has overcome the problem that center coil heating is concentrated, has improved the heating homogeneity of electromagnetism dish that generates heat.

Background technique
Existing cooking machine can stir triturable multi-functional because that can heat, and it is easy to use etc. excellent to stir good crushing effect etc.
Point has got the favour of people and has approved, at indispensable electric appliance in for people's lives.
More and more hot type broken wall cooking machines use electromagnetic coil heating method currently on the market, due to electromagnetic heating
Coil, which has, concentrates heat characteristic, i.e. coil Edge Heating heat is low, and centre heating heat is big, at work intermediate obtained heat
Amount is big, and intermediate coil temperature is also high, so that heating is uneven, infusion effect is bad.
Therefore it in order to improve the infusion uniformity, needs to be adjusted correspondingly the structure of electromagnetic heating coil.
